Socket
Socket
Sign inDemoInstall

moment-parseformat

Package Overview
Dependencies
Maintainers
2
Versions
29
Alerts
File Explorer

Advanced tools

Socket logo

Install Socket

Detect and block malicious and high-risk dependencies

Install

moment-parseformat - npm Package Compare versions

Comparing version 2.0.1 to 2.1.0

9

lib/parseformat.js

@@ -40,2 +40,5 @@ module.exports = parseFormat

var regexHoursMinutesSeconds = /\d{1,2}:\d{2}:\d{2}/
var regexHoursMinutesSecondsMilliseconds = /\d{1,2}:\d{2}:\d{2}\.\d{3}/
var regexHoursMinutesSecondsCentiSeconds = /\d{1,2}:\d{2}:\d{2}\.\d{2}/
var regexHoursMinutesSecondsDeciSeconds = /\d{1,2}:\d{2}:\d{2}\.\d{1}/
var regexHoursMinutes = /\d{1,2}:\d{2}/

@@ -130,2 +133,8 @@ var regexYearLong = /\d{4}/

format = format.replace(regexHoursWithLeadingZeroMinutesSeconds, 'HH:mm:ss')
// 5:30:20.222 ☛ H:mm:ss.SSS
format = format.replace(regexHoursMinutesSecondsMilliseconds, 'H:mm:ss.SSS')
// 5:30:20.22 ☛ H:mm:ss.SS
format = format.replace(regexHoursMinutesSecondsCentiSeconds, 'H:mm:ss.SS')
// 5:30:20.2 ☛ H:mm:ss.S
format = format.replace(regexHoursMinutesSecondsDeciSeconds, 'H:mm:ss.S')
// 10:30:20 ☛ H:mm:ss

@@ -132,0 +141,0 @@ format = format.replace(regexHoursMinutesSeconds, 'H:mm:ss')

2

package.json

@@ -61,3 +61,3 @@ {

},
"version": "2.0.1"
"version": "2.1.0"
}

@@ -63,2 +63,6 @@ 'use strict'

// https://github.com/gr2m/moment-parseformat/pull/45
t.equal(moment.parseFormat('Feb 1 2016 1:03:22.111'), 'MMM D YYYY H:mm:ss.SSS', 'Feb 1 2016 1:03:22.111 → MMM D YYYY H:mm:ss.SSS')
t.equal(moment.parseFormat('Feb 1 2016 1:03:22.11'), 'MMM D YYYY H:mm:ss.SS', 'Feb 1 2016 1:03:22.111 → MMM D YYYY H:mm:ss.SS')
t.equal(moment.parseFormat('Feb 1 2016 1:03:22.1'), 'MMM D YYYY H:mm:ss.S', 'Feb 1 2016 1:03:22.111 → MMM D YYYY H:mm:ss.S')
t.end()

@@ -65,0 +69,0 @@ })

SocketSocket SOC 2 Logo

Product

  • Package Alerts
  • Integrations
  • Docs
  • Pricing
  • FAQ
  • Roadmap
  • Changelog

Packages

npm

Stay in touch

Get open source security insights delivered straight into your inbox.


  • Terms
  • Privacy
  • Security

Made with ⚡️ by Socket Inc